:root{
    --btn-bg-color:#191919;
    --input-bg-color:#191919;
}
html,body{height:100%}
.btn{border:1px solid gray;padding:5px 15px;border-radius: 5px;background-color:var(--btn-bg-color) ;color:white}
.btn_s{border:1px solid gray;padding:3px 5px;border-radius: 5px;background-color:var(--btn-bg-color) ;color:white}
.btn_a{border:1px solid gray;padding:3px 10px;border-radius: 5px;background-color:var(--btn-bg-color) ;color:white}
.btn_w{border:1px solid gray;padding:5px 15px;border-radius: 5px;background-color:white ;color:black;font-size:14px}
.btn_ws{border:1px solid gray;padding:5px 3px;border-radius: 5px;background-color:white ;color:black;font-size:14px}

.input{border:1px solid gray;padding:5px 15px;border-radius: 5px;background-color:var(--btn-bg-color) ;color:white;text-align: center}

.login-table tr td {padding:10px}
.list_th{background-color: var(--btn-bg-color);color:white;}
.list_input{border:none;width:50px;text-align: right;color:#666}
.list_mark{border:none;text-align:left;font-size:12px;color:#666;width:70px}

.td_desc{max-width:75px;text-overflow:ellipsis;white-space:nowrap;overflow:hidden;}

.p5{padding:10px 8px}
.iconSize{width:25px;height:25px}

.float_new{position: fixed;bottom:20px;right:20px;z-index:999;text-align: center;font-size:56px;border-radius: 50%;-webkit-border-radius:50%;-moz-border-radius:50%;width:50px;height:50px;line-height:50px}
.nickname{width:90:px;overflow:hidden;
    white-space:nowrap;
    text-overflow:ellipsis;
    -o-text-overflow:ellipsis;
    -moz-text-overflow: ellipsis;
    -webkit-text-overflow: ellipsis;}